What is Creative Commons?• Creative Commons is a nonprofit organization that enables the

sharing and use of creativity and knowledge through free legal tools.

• Creative Commons are free, easy-to-use copyright licenses which provide a simple, standardized way to give the public permission to share and use your creative work — on conditions of your choice. CC licenses let you easily change your copyright terms from the default of “all rights reserved” to “some rights reserved.”

• Creative Commons licenses are not an alternative to copyright. They work alongside copyright and enable you to modify your copyright terms to best suit your needs.

What can Creative Commons do for me?

• If you want to give people the right to share, use, and even build upon a work you’ve created, you should consider publishing it under a Creative Commons license.

• CC gives you flexibility (for example, you can choose to allow only non-commercial uses) and protects the people who use your work, so they don’t have to worry about copyright infringement, as long as they abide by the conditions you have specified.

• If you’re looking for content that you can freely and legally use, there is a giant pool of CC-licensed creativity available to you.

• There are hundreds of millions of works — from songs and videos to scientific and academic material — available to the public for free and legal use under the terms of our copyright licenses, with more being contributed every day.

cc Licensing Schemes

1. Attribution CC BY2. Attribution-ShareAlike  CC BY-SA3. Attribution-NoDerivs  CC BY-ND4. Attribution-NonCommercial  CC BY-NC5. Attribution-NonCommercial-ShareAlike  CC 

BY-NC-SA6. Attribution-NonCommercial-NoDerivs  CC 

BY-NC-ND

Page 7: Creative commons nigeria kayode

1. Attribution CC BYThis license lets others distribute, remix, tweak, and build upon your work, even commercially, as long as they credit you for the original creation. This is the most accommodating of licenses offered. Recommended for maximum dissemination and use of licensed materials.

2. Attribution-ShareAlike  CC BY-SAThis license lets others remix, tweak, and build upon your work even for commercial purposes, as long as they credit you and license their new creations under the identical terms. This license is often compared to “copyleft” free and open source software licenses. All new works based on yours will carry the same license, so any derivatives will also allow commercial use. This is the license used by Wikipedia, and is recommended for materials that would benefit from incorporating content from Wikipedia and similarly licensed projects.

3. Attribution-NoDerivs CC BY-NDThis license allows for redistribution, commercial and non-commercial, as long as it is passed along unchanged and in whole, with credit to you.

4. Attribution-NonCommercial CC BY-NCThis license lets others remix, tweak, and build upon your work non-commercially, and although their new works must also acknowledge you and be non-commercial, they don’t have to license their derivative works on the same terms.

cc Licensing Schemes

Page 9: Creative commons nigeria kayode

5. Attribution-NonCommercial-ShareAlike CC BY-NC-SAThis license lets others remix, tweak, and build upon your work non-commercially, as long as they credit you and license their new creations under the identical terms.

6. Attribution-NonCommercial-NoDerivs CC BY-NC-NDThis license is the most restrictive of our six main licenses, only allowing others to download your works and share them with others as long as they credit you, but they can’t change them in any way or use them commercially.

The Nigerian Team

The Nigerian team is organized into three sections of volunteers;1.Legal Lead,2.Public Lead,3.Technical Lead

Page 14: Creative commons nigeria kayode

• The legal lead is a team of legal experts who understands licensing issues.

• The legal lead is to give legal advice to the community.

• The legal lead in Nigeria is a law firm called Kusamotu and Kusamotu

• The firm is headed by Ayo Kusamotu

The Nigerian Team

Page 15: Creative commons nigeria kayode

• The Public lead is meant to be a public institution that has influence in government’s legal policy making

• cc Nigeria is in talks with a reputable institution and as such, we cannot make public the name of the institution at this point.

• Alternately, the public lead is Ms. Edefe Ojomo, a law lecturer in University of Lagos

The Nigerian Team

Page 16: Creative commons nigeria kayode

• The technical team is to handle technical issues

• The team is expected to bridge the technological divide to the legal practitioners

• The team is led by Kayode Yussuf• Other team members are Richard Essien and

Olushola Olaniyan
